Though modest in size, Deighton station boasts essential amenities designed to facilitate your travel. There’s no traditional ticket office, but not to worry—there are ticket machines available for collecting online purchases, including accessible machines for travelers with disabilities. Additionally, an indu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ments, ensuring everyone who passes through can embark on their way with ease.
Regarding accessibility, you'll find the station accommodating. While it’s categorized as a Category B station with partial step-free access, ramps allow for easy navigation to the platforms via the main road. There’s no need for advance booking if you require assistance—boarding ramps are carried on all trains, and you can simply request help from a conductor on site.
While Deighton doesn’t offer amenities like wa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, the focus remains squarely on efficient travel. However, if you're in need of a taxi once you arrive or depart, you can arrange one conveniently through services like Cab4You.
Deighton station is well-positioned for various modes of onward transport. Though direct bus services in the immediate vicinity are limited, nearby bus stops on Leeds Road provide routes toward Leeds and Huddersfield. If you're looking to explore further afield, the station is a short hop away from the bustling hubs of Leeds and Manchester Piccadilly, providing a launchpad to destinations throughout the UK.

While Acton Bridge (Cheshire) Station might have a no-frills appearance, it accommodates the fundamental needs of its passengers. Though there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for your convenience, including accessible options. Unfortunately, you cannot collect tickets bought online at this station. Smartcards are neither issued nor validated here, and you’ll find no waiting rooms or shops for refreshments. However, on the plus side, the station has a small parking area available to travelers, which is open 24 hours a day, and best of all, parking here is free!
The station doesn’t possess step-free access, making mobility a challenge for some passengers. However, an assistance meeting point is available on the platform for those needing help boarding the train. Bear in mind, there’s no staff on hand for assistance at any time, so pre-arrangement through passenger assist services is advised for those needing help with access.
Even though the station lacks a variety of transport links, basic options for onward travel remain. A rail replacement service is available, operating from the front of the station, and while local bus service information can be found online, you may wish to plan in advance for these connections due to their limited nature.
